£20m project aims to fight ‘unique’ flood threats

Significant flood defenses protecting large areas of the Norfolk Broads are being strengthened for the future as £20 million work takes shape.
Eleven pump stations in the Upper Thurne catchment are being upgraded, helping to protect more than 700 properties and nature areas across 15,500 acres at high risk of flooding due to hazards from both storm surges and heavy rainfall.
The new technology will increase water pumping capacity by 50%, according to the Water Management Association (WMA), a group of inland drainage boards in Norfolk and Suffolk.
WMA chief operating officer Mark Philpot said the plan would make the Broads “more dynamic and adaptable” to climate change.

Why is it necessary?
More than 2,000 years ago the Broads were a large estuary, but over several centuries the land was drained by diverting rivers, digging drainage channels and using wind pumps to move water.
Protected wetlands make up around 1% of the country’s land area but are home to a quarter of Britain’s rarest wildlife. The changing climate puts these habitats under threat.
Extreme weather conditions and rising sea levels are placing increasing pressures on the Broads, with prolonged flooding, tidal surges and salt inundation threatening sensitive freshwater habitats in the region.
Villagers living in places such as Hickling and Potter Heigham faced long-term floods two years ago, and some households were unable to use their toilets because their sewage systems were filled with floodwater.
However, during the summer months the region is also particularly vulnerable to drought; This means water levels require careful management.
WMA chief operating officer Matthew Philpot said: “Upper Thurne is a very special part of the Broads because it is home to many important wildlife reserves and communities that rely on flood defences.
“Norfolk has unique flood threats from the sea, rivers and sky.
“Any type of flooding can occur and the Broads in particular are very low lying so there is a lot of infrastructure that we rely on to keep us dry.”

What are pump stations for?
Many of the reclaimed areas are located next to the historic wind pumps that helped dry the Broads land for centuries, and the buildings remain a significant feature of the landscape.
The technology was introduced by Dutch engineers in the 17th century and modern pumping stations work in a similar way, but the way they are operated has changed.
Although the method is similar, the new facilities are now much more efficient, Philpot said.
“The technology uses the same principle; you basically lift water from a lower level to a higher level to keep these areas dry,” he said.
“We switched from wind to diesel and now we run on electricity.
“We tend to put our pumps in the same location because they knew where the best place to pump on the land was. We’re following in their footsteps.”

Why do they need an upgrade?
To better prepare for the future, WMA aims to upgrade its pump stations with modern, much more efficient facilities capable of discharging 50% more water.
The current project aims to replace 11 stations over ten years at a cost of around £3.5 million for each site in the Upper Thurne catchment, which includes villages such as Hickling, Martham and Potter Heigham.
But Philpot added that there were ambitions to eventually replace all 37 pump stations on the Broads.
At Horsey, where the finishing touches are being made, the two pumps will each be able to move up to 375 liters (82 gallons) of water per second.
A new pumping station has also been installed at St Benet’s.
WMA said the replacement pump stations were mostly built in the 1950s and are now “significantly beyond the end of their design life.”
More “fish-friendly” technology is also being used and pumps will be able to better control the level of water transported to ensure water levels are managed during drier periods.

The £20m funding package comes as part of the £1.4bn investment in flood protection announced by the Environment Agency and the Department for Environment, Food and Rural Affairs in March this year.
Other areas to benefit include Poole Port, Somerset and Kendal in Cumbria.
A spokesman for the Environment Agency said: “We are very supportive of work to improve pump stations in Upper Thurne.
“These are particularly important because they will help support the effective management of a unique, diverse and highly managed landscape that is low-lying and below sea level.”
The EA added that it was supporting other projects to manage flood risk and resilience in Norfolk, including improvements to Great Yarmouth defenses and £1.5 million for the maintenance of floodwalls and other river maintenance projects.
